My husband did this once, drove off forgetting that it wasn’t a pay at the pump petrol station. The police turned up at the door to tell us he hadn’t paid a few weeks later. He went along to the petrol station to pay it and that was that. If it makes you feel any better I think it’s quite common, the staff had to work through a big list of unpaid fuel to find the right transaction for my husband to pay. Your number plate will have been captured at the station, always best to try to track them down yourself if you can before the police turn up. I imagine you’ll be able to pay over the phone.
